Backup Lamps Inoperative

| 3 | Is only one lamp inoperative? | Go to Step 9 | Go to Step 4 |
| 4 |
|
Go to Step 5 | Go to Step 7 |
| 5 | Connect a 10-amp fused jumper between the switch side battery positive voltage circuit of the backup lamp relay and the backup lamp voltage supply circuit of the backup lamp relay. Do the backup lamps illuminate? |
Go to Step 8 | Go to Step 6 |
| 6 | Test for an open or high resistance in the backup lamp voltage supply circuit. Refer to Circuit Testing
and Wiring Repairs
. Did you find and correct the condition? |
Go to Step 12 | Go to Step 7 |
| 7 | Inspect for poor connections at the fuse block - rear. Refer to Testing for Intermittent Conditions and Poor Connections
and Connector Repairs
. Did you find and correct the condition? |
Go to Step 12 | Go to Step 10 |
| 8 | Inspect for poor connections at the backup lamp relay. Refer to Testing for Intermittent Conditions and Poor Connections
and Connector Repairs
. Did you find and correct the condition? |
Go to Step 12 | Go to Step 11 |
| 9 | Repair an open, high resistance, or short to ground in the backup lamp voltage supply circuit or the ground circuit of the inoperative lamp. Refer to Circuit Testing
and Wiring Repairs
. Did you complete the repair? |
Go to Step 12 | - |
| 10 | Replace the fuse block - rear. Did you complete the replacement? |
Go to Step 12 | - |
| 11 | Replace the backup lamp relay. Refer to Relay Replacement (Attached to Wire Harness)
or Relay Replacement (Within an Electrical Center)
. Did you complete the replacement? |
Go to Step 12 | - |
| 12 | Operate the system in order to verify the repair. Did you correct the condition? |
System OK | Go to Step 2 |
